Centro Plaza, VIA Metropolitan Transit’s state-of-the-art transit hub, is home to the latest installation of IKE Smart City kiosks, a new, interactive wayfinding and information system in Downtown San Antonio. The Interactive Kiosk Experience platform—IKE for short—makes it easy to navigate VIA service, receive real-time traffic and transit information, find places to shop and eat nearby, and access City services. VIA joins the City of San Antonio in partnering with IKE Smart City, aimed at creating value for transit customers and Downtown visitors.

“VIA is reimagining transit in our region with partnerships and programs that support innovation, like IKE Smart City,” VIA President/CEO Jeffrey C. Arndt said. “Over 1 million passengers travel to Centro Plaza each year. They now have an interactive, easy-to-use portal with fun and helpful digital tools as part of a modern transportation system.”

Each IKE Smart City has a double-sided digital display with apps offering an array of uses, such as helping pedestrians discover nearby attractions and parks while providing them with multi-modal directions to nearby destinations. Information about public events or public safety can be pushed to the kiosks in real-time, and users can transfer information to their smart phones. Among its many features, IKE Smart City monitors air quality, offers interactive games, and has cameras for selfies. IKE Smart City puts smart technology on the ground to drive discovery, mobility, and equity across the economic spectrum. The digital kiosks connect residents and visitors to local businesses, entertainment, and resources and also facilitate navigation around the city, providing directions, mapping, and real-time transit information for both mass and micro transit modalities. Additionally, IKE will serve as the nexus of a series of smart mobility hubs that connect mass transit with first and last mile micro-transit such as scooters and ebikes, and provide the information and route-planning functionality to enable low-cost, convenient, and environmentally sensitive transportation options.


 

“We are thrilled to partner with the City of San Antonio, one of the fastest growing and most innovative cities in the country,” said Pete Scantland, CEO of IKE Smart City. “IKE will help residents and visitors discover the city, providing better access to public transportation, and narrowing the digital divide by improving connectivity and access to civic and social resources. The addition of IKE kiosks will help to activate and enliven the pedestrian experience in San Antonio, and provides the City and other stakeholders with a powerful platform to deliver critical information to on-the-go residents and visitors throughout San Antonio.”

Future IKE Smart City locations include: VIA Five Points Transfer Area, VIA Medical Transit Center, VIA Ingram Transit Center, VIA Kel-Lac Transit Center, and VIA Brooks Transit Center. The partnership requires no additional funding from VIA and will generate revenue that can be reinvested into city programs and improvements.
